HEADS UP: Hot stuff from Zogby |
|
Zogby has a scroll running on his website. The scroll reads:
John Zogby: "Watch Colorado, Florida, Pennsylvania, and Virginia. There may be some big surprises!" 11:43 AM - 11-02-04
We called the folks at Zogby, and according to their numbers right now, Bush is +3 in Florida, Kerry is +3 in Colorado, and there will be a tie in Pennsylvania and Virginia.
This could be excellent news, or it could be a disaster. If Kerry picks up Colorado, Pennsylvania, Virginia *and* Ohio, you can turn out the lights.
Stay tuned.
